## Deployment

If you're new to the Larkspindle scheduler, read this before touching production. Last quarter we investigated cron drift on the Veldmere cluster: jobs were firing up to 40 seconds late because the host clock synced against a stale peer. We now pin NTP sources at deploy time and verify offsets during the health check. Deployments must run the drift probe before traffic is admitted. The values below reflect the current drift-safe deployment configuration.

settings of fawip-yadug:
[druath]
port = 3000
region = north-4
host = druath.qirvanworks.corp
timeout_ms = 1500
retries = 1

**Release checklist — Step 14: Verify log sampling on murmurbus-relay**

The murmurbus-relay service emits roughly forty log lines per request, so unsampled logging will saturate the Pellworth ingest tier within minutes of rollout. Before promoting, confirm the sampling rate is set to the agreed 1:100 for info-level lines and that error-level lines remain unsampled. Validate by comparing ingest volume against the previous release window. Record the candidate artifact you verified so future maintainers can audit this step; the token goes below.

pipeline stamp: htk4_ae36

# Break-Glass Access — Addrly Autocomplete Widget

If the Addrly address autocomplete widget fails open and leaks partial suggestions, engineers may use break-glass access to disable it fleet-wide. Log the action in the sync notes and notify Marek's team within an hour. The break-glass console prompts once; authenticate with the recovery passphrase below.

strongbox words: sorir-belvan-rusix-ulays-ralmir-praix-eliir-tamax-praael-druael-julir-tamius-jorir